Common Challenges in Ecommerce Web Development
Ecommerce development is not without its challenges. Certain problems consistently plague online stores, making them stumbling blocks that need careful attention. Here are some of the most frequent issues businesses face:
- Site Speed Issues: Slow loading sites frustrate visitors, leading them to leave before purchasing. This can negatively affect your search ranking and reduce sales opportunities.
- Mobile Responsiveness Failures: With more shoppers using mobile devices, sites must adapt to smaller screens. A lack of mobile optimization can drive away potential customers.
- Poor User Experience: Complex navigation or unclear paths to purchase often result in abandoned shopping carts. A user-friendly design ensures visitors find what they're looking for with ease.
When these challenges are not managed effectively, they impact customer satisfaction and sales. Visitors who encounter a frustrating user experience are less likely to return, impacting immediate revenue and long-term business growth. Addressing these issues properly can give your site the edge it needs to exceed customer expectations.
Strategies to Overcome Ecommerce Development Issues
Tackling ecommerce development issues requires a practical approach. Here are some strategies to improve your online store's functionality and user experience:
1. Improve Site Speed:
- Use image compression tools to reduce file sizes without losing quality.
- Opt for a reliable hosting service with good server response times.
- Minimize the use of heavy scripts and plugins.
2. Enhance Mobile Responsiveness:
- Design with a mobile-first approach, ensuring all features are accessible on smartphones.
- Use responsive design frameworks like Bootstrap or Flexbox.
- Regularly test your site's appearance across various mobile devices.
3. Boost User Experience:
- Simplify navigation menus to make products easier to find.
- Use clear calls to action that guide users through the purchasing process.
- Incorporate customer reviews and ratings to build trust.
These strategies not only resolve current problems but set your ecommerce platform up for continued success. Providing a fast, mobile-friendly, and engaging shopping experience can significantly enhance customer satisfaction and loyalty. This approach ensures visitors can quickly find and purchase what they’re looking for, paving the way for increased sales and a solid reputation.
Future-Proofing Your Ecommerce Website
Keeping your ecommerce site relevant and effective isn't just about addressing present challenges. It's important to think ahead to ensure your store remains cutting-edge as technology evolves. Scalability is key here. As your business grows, your website should handle increases in traffic and inventory. Building a scalable infrastructure from the start prevents the need for significant overhauls later.
Security is another critical aspect to focus on. Regular updates and patches for your ecommerce platform protect against potential vulnerabilities. That is crucial for maintaining customer trust, as data breaches can severely impact your reputation. Additionally, keeping an eye on emerging technology trends allows you to integrate new features that enhance the user experience, such as voice search or augmented reality.
